Application:
The rotor spinning machine is used in the production of a variety of materials, including corduroy, denim, Khaki, yarn-dyed fabric, printed cloth, cotton blanket, bath towel and decorative cloths. The suitable yarn density is 97-14.5tex(3-40Ne)

Main features:
600 rotors design
The machine can be up to 600 rotors with rotor speed 120000rpm which can realize higher productivity. Less single rotor power consumption, higher speed, less labor can achieve more profit. For example, 600rotors, Ne21, daily capacity 2160kgs
Electronic traverse mechanism
Driven by servo system, can keep good deforming quality in 200m/min delivery speed
Double side separate driving
Double side separate driving, double transport yarn convey, double side separate start & stop, which can realize one machine can make two different yarns
Yarn ends retain function
Equip loop compensator and yarn end retain function after cone dropped, which can reduce worker working force. Auto doffing machine is available.
Closed loop control system
Adopt new energy-saving driving motors driven by inverters. Closed loop vacuum pressure control system can adjust fan speed for stable vacuum pressure, which can realize better quality and energy saving,
Double exhaust impurities design
JWF1618, if above 300 rotors, adopts double exhaust impurities design at headstock and tail of machine. The special design branch pipes can reduce the vacuum loss and increase the yarn quality. For example, 500 rotors machine pressure difference is only 200-300Pa. This design can save around 5% energy compared with former models
Double side electrical yarn move
The electrical yarn move can reduce the cots wearing. The cots are PU material which service life is 5 times than rubber cots.
Mature and stable spin box
Optimize the feeding and opening area and sliver fed by the step motor control, and the rotor speed can be up to 120000rpm. More raw materials are available, especially for the lower quality fiber
Optimized piecing system(PIDSPIN)
Single motor sliver feeding can protect the pieced fiber no damage. The semi-automated piecing technology PIDSPIN designed by PID can adjust the sliver feeding quantity to make sure the yarn piecing area is same in quality and appearance.
The piecing principle is based on each step digital accurate control. The worker shall prepare the proper yarn end and put it into the take-up pipe, and it would start automatically after spin box closed. The operation is easier and less fault. The worker can leave earlier than before and solve the other unit.
Perfect Winding quality(PIDWIND)
The new advanced neural network learning algorithm process with PIDWIND winding technology offer better cone quality, especially in size, unwinding performance, evenness etc. The quality cone can supply supplier bigger market.
Loop compensator immediately stores the delivery surplus of yarn at the moment of piecing, which ensures excellent winding quality and better unwinding. The piecing yarn strength is above 70%.
